Heater Hoses?

I want to do a coolant flush on my new to me Ex. Are these the heater hoses with some type of sensor on top? From reading past threads, it's a vacuum actuated heater control valve? Looks like I have two heater hoses: one for front and one for rear? If I am to use a "T" to flush the cooling system, should I tap into the one leading to the engine?

Both those hoses should go into the heater core, one is feed and the other is return.

When I flushed mine, I just pulled a radiator hose and ran the engine while flushing it. If you cycle the heater to max hot, you'll flush the core out as well. That switch should be the vacuum actuated heat control from the dash panel IIRC.
